Area of use 
The Door Terminal Basic is an electronic door fitting used principally 
in the hotel sector. It is mounted on interior doors with mortise locks 
acc. to DIN 18 251 and can also easily be retrofitted on the door leaf. 
Depending on the design, the fixing plate on the Door Terminal Basic  
can also be mounted on doors whose mortise locks deviate from DIN 
18 251. 
Technical information 
 
All Door Terminals Basic are supplied in the simple operating 
mode. In this operating mode, access rights for up to 26 electronic 
keys can be allocated directly at the Door Terminal Basic with a 
special Programming ADD Key-stick (green). These access rights 
can be withdrawn again from an authorised electronic key at the 
Door Terminal Basic  using a Programming DELETE Key-stick 
(red). Please contact your Dialock distributor if a different operating 
mode is to be selected. 
 
The Door Terminal Basic  consists of the outer module (fixing plate 
with bracket and cover) that is mounted on the outer side of the 
door, and rosette fittings that are mounted on the inside of the door. 
 
The Door Terminal Basic  has no infrared interface but can be 
configured using Parameter and Special Transponders. 
 
The Door Terminal Basic  is battery-powered, and operated using 
electronic keys.
